Output c8e295f3e64e6431cbbcb8f3cdec875f4c603754cd0e08a509b4e41c69dec671:24

value
307123
script pubkey
OP_0 OP_PUSHBYTES_20 2e5101d72313827a65cce507e18343e8ca588b89
address
bc1q9egsr4erzwp85ewvu5r7rq6rar993zufv4sua2
transaction
c8e295f3e64e6431cbbcb8f3cdec875f4c603754cd0e08a509b4e41c69dec671
confirmations
143586
spent
true